The popularity of user-generated, short-form video is increasing with many factors working in its favor. The limited video format highlights a person''s creativity as they showcase educational, informative or entertaining content while using filters, editing tools and incorporating sound and music. The end result can often go viral. Marketers are using the power of the format to target diverse, engaged and specifically younger audiences. When TikTok, the short-video app of China''s ByteDance, became a hit it was logical that companies, even politicians, began to notice. Former U.S. President Donald Trump''s call to ban the app in the U.S., primarily due to his animosity toward China, opened the floodgates of people joining TikTok. Senate committee passes bill aimed at Apple, Google''s app stores
07:30pm, Thursday, 03'rd Feb 2022 MarketWatch
The Senate Judiciary Committee on Thursday overwhelmingly passed a bill aimed at curtailing the market power of Apple Inc.''s and Google parent Alphabet Inc.''s app stores. By a 20-2 vote, the committee pushed along the Open App Markets Act, with only Sens. John Cornyn, R-Texas, and Thom Tillis, R-N.C., in opposition. It is the second tech competition bill passed by the committee this year. Last month, the panel advanced the American Innovation and Choice Online Act, which would accomplish some of the same goals but is broader and could apply to Amazon.com Inc. and Meta Platforms Inc. as well. Both bills, which go to the full Senate, are intended to help developers led by advocates such as Epic Games Inc., Spotify Technology , and Match Group Inc. . Retail Investors Are Flooding In To Buy Meta''s Face-plant Dip
06:00pm, Thursday, 03'rd Feb 2022 Zero Hedge
Retail Investors Are Flooding In To Buy Meta''s Face-plant Dip Years of BTFD instinct don''t go away just like that, and with Facebook plunging the 26%, its biggest drop ever, and also the biggest loss of market cap by any company in US history - putting it in context FB has lost more value today than the market cap of 455 S&P500 members - and after its opening collapse, the retail crew has arrived and according to Fidelity, thousands of retail investors are buying the dip this morning. According to Fidelity , FB was by far the most traded among individual investors using Fidelitys platform, with volumes more than five times that of Tesla, the second-most traded stock according to Bloomberg. The imbalance was 80% in favor of dip buyers, with more than 49k buy orders placed on the platform as of 11:52am, compared to 12k sell orders as of 11:52 a.m. in New York. In context, the staggering amount of buy orders was roughly seven times the demand for Amazon, the second-most bought stock. The flood of retail buying is hardly as surprise, and it represents a continuation of the relentless, if somewhat more subdued, purchases by ordinary investors.
